Abstract: | Vertical microprogramming (or, as others say, functional microprogramming or firmware) was introduced in contrast with Wilkes' microprogramming (generally called horizontal or structural microprogramming), and has greatly enhanced the use of microprogramming in control design and implementation. As applied today, the former technique is not yet a way of designing control structures, but an additional software level whose implications in the system are not well clarified. |